Bhubaneswar, April 6: The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P) celebrated its 46th Foundation Day with great enthusiasm across Odisha, with the central event taking place at the party’s state headquarters in Bhubaneswar. The occasion witnessed a massive turnout of party workers and leaders, including Odisha Chief Minister Mohan Charan Majhi, State BJP President Manmohan Samal, and party in-charge Vijay Pal Singh Tomar.

Marking the event, Manmohan Samal hoisted the party flag at his residence early in the day, followed by the main celebration at the party office. Addressing the gathering, Samal expressed gratitude to the people of Odisha, highlighting that the BJP currently has over 40 lakh members in the state, with an ambitious goal of doubling the number in the coming year.

Chief Minister Majhi extended his greetings on the occasion, calling the BJP a “nationwide movement” built on the dedication and sacrifices of its workers. He urged everyone to continue working for the development of both Odisha and the nation.

Speaking to party workers, Samal noted the significance of the day coinciding with Ram Navami, stating, “There is renewed energy among our karyakartas as we mark this special day. The party has grown through years of struggle and is now leading the country under the dynamic leadership of Prime Minister Narendra Modi, just as it was once guided by Atal Bihari Vajpayee.”

Samal further emphasized that the BJP's continued success is a reflection of the people’s trust, stating, “We are fortunate to receive the people’s mandate for the third time nationally and for the first time in Odisha.”

The celebration included cultural performances, speeches by senior leaders, and reaffirmation of the party’s commitment to public service and good governance.
